C# Class UnityHTTP.Request

Datei anzeigen Open project: andyburke/UnityHTTP Class Usage Examples

Public Properties

Property Type Description
EOL byte[]
LogAllRequests bool
VerboseLogging bool
acceptGzip bool
bufferSize int
byteStream Stream
completedCallback Action
cookieJar CookieJar
exception System.Exception
isDone bool
maximumRetryCount int
method string
operatingSystem string
protocol string
response Response
responseTime long
state RequestState
synchronous bool
unityVersion string
uri System.Uri
useCache bool

Public Methods

Method Description
AddHeader ( string name, string value ) : void
GetHeader ( string name ) : string
GetHeaders ( ) : List
GetHeaders ( string name ) : List
InfoString ( bool verbose ) : string
Request ( string method, string uri ) : System
Request ( string method, string uri, Hashtable data ) : System
Request ( string method, string uri, StreamedWWWForm form ) : System
Request ( string method, string uri, WWWForm form ) : System
Request ( string method, string uri, bool useCache ) : System
Request ( string method, string uri, byte bytes ) : System
Send ( Action callback = null ) : void
SetHeader ( string name, string value ) : void
ValidateServerCertificate ( object sender, X509Certificate certificate, X509Chain chain, SslPolicyErrors sslPolicyErrors ) : bool

Private Methods

Method Description
GetResponse ( ) : void
WriteToStream ( Stream outputStream ) : void

Method Details

AddHeader() public method

public AddHeader ( string name, string value ) : void
name string
value string
return void

GetHeader() public method

public GetHeader ( string name ) : string
name string
return string

GetHeaders() public method

public GetHeaders ( ) : List
return List

GetHeaders() public method

public GetHeaders ( string name ) : List
name string
return List

InfoString() public method

public InfoString ( bool verbose ) : string
verbose bool
return string

Request() public method

public Request ( string method, string uri ) : System
method string
uri string
return System

Request() public method

public Request ( string method, string uri, Hashtable data ) : System
method string
uri string
data System.Collections.Hashtable
return System

Request() public method

public Request ( string method, string uri, StreamedWWWForm form ) : System
method string
uri string
form StreamedWWWForm
return System

Request() public method

public Request ( string method, string uri, WWWForm form ) : System
method string
uri string
form UnityEngine.WWWForm
return System

Request() public method

public Request ( string method, string uri, bool useCache ) : System
method string
uri string
useCache bool
return System

Request() public method

public Request ( string method, string uri, byte bytes ) : System
method string
uri string
bytes byte
return System

Send() public method

public Send ( Action callback = null ) : void
callback Action
return void

SetHeader() public method

public SetHeader ( string name, string value ) : void
name string
value string
return void

ValidateServerCertificate() public static method

public static ValidateServerCertificate ( object sender, X509Certificate certificate, X509Chain chain, SslPolicyErrors sslPolicyErrors ) : bool
sender object
certificate System.Security.Cryptography.X509Certificates.X509Certificate
chain System.Security.Cryptography.X509Certificates.X509Chain
sslPolicyErrors SslPolicyErrors
return bool

Property Details

EOL public_oe static_oe property

public static byte[] EOL
return byte[]

LogAllRequests public_oe static_oe property

public static bool LogAllRequests
return bool

VerboseLogging public_oe static_oe property

public static bool VerboseLogging
return bool

acceptGzip public_oe property

public bool acceptGzip
return bool

bufferSize public_oe property

public int bufferSize
return int

byteStream public_oe property

public Stream byteStream
return Stream

completedCallback public_oe property

public Action completedCallback
return Action

cookieJar public_oe property

public CookieJar,UnityHTTP cookieJar
return CookieJar

exception public_oe property

public Exception,System exception
return System.Exception

isDone public_oe property

public bool isDone
return bool

maximumRetryCount public_oe property

public int maximumRetryCount
return int

method public_oe property

public string method
return string

operatingSystem public_oe static_oe property

public static string operatingSystem
return string

protocol public_oe property

public string protocol
return string

response public_oe property

public Response,UnityHTTP response
return Response

responseTime public_oe property

public long responseTime
return long

state public_oe property

public RequestState state
return RequestState

synchronous public_oe property

public bool synchronous
return bool

unityVersion public_oe static_oe property

public static string unityVersion
return string

uri public_oe property

public Uri,System uri
return System.Uri

useCache public_oe property

public bool useCache
return bool